[ARCHIVED] Police Investigating Dead Body Found At Geneva Golf Club

Geneva Police and Fire departments were dispatched at 1:29 p.m. Dec. 26 to investigate a dead body located in a creek at the Geneva Golf Club, 831 South St.

Upon their arrival, safety personnel found a man lying face down in the creek near hole No. 6, and he appeared to be unresponsive. Firefighters investigated and then contacted Delnor Hospital, where the man was pronounced deceased at 1:50 p.m.

The man has been identified as John A. Gaines, 74, of Geneva. He was a long-time resident of the community and husband of Jean Gaines, the Geneva Chamber of Commerce President.

Police are investigating the circumstances of Gaines’ activities prior to his death. Though there is nothing to indicate foul play and/or criminal activity, the Geneva Police Department will continue to investigate the circumstances of this case until a cause of death has been determined by the Kane County Coroner’s Office.
